Distance From Meekatharra Airport to Albany Airport (MKR - ALH Distance)

The flight distance from Meekatharra Airport (MKR) to Albany Airport (ALH) is 578 miles. This is equivalent to 930 kilometers or 502 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.


930 kilometers is the distance from Meekatharra Airport, Australia to Albany Airport, Australia.
